Abstract

The present invention is an umbrella dryer made to avoid the inconvenience of the user when entering the room by drying the umbrella in a short period of time using hot air after using the umbrella in the rain.

The first embodiment of the present invention has a main body that can be unfolded after inserting the umbrella, the main body is a fixed portion for fixing the umbrella, the power supply for operating the device, blowing air to create a wind in the lower body The wind formed by the means and the blowing means is configured to remove water while flowing on the umbrella surface.

The second embodiment of the present invention has a main body having an insert portion of the umbrella, the main body is a power supply for operating the device at the lower end, a rotating part for rotating the umbrella, a blowing means for generating wind at the top and the blowing means The wind created by the wind flows on the surface of the umbrella and is configured to remove moisture.

Umbrella Dryer {Umbrella Dryer}

The present invention is a device made to drop or remove the water on the surface of the umbrella while hot air made by the blowing means is connected to the main body and the compression type blowing means that the umbrella can be inserted. The operation of the device is operated when the umbrella presses the power installed under the umbrella stand, and the water collected below is discharged through the inclined outlet so that the user has to deal with the water collected at the bottom periodically. prevent.

If you enter the room after using the umbrella in rainy weather, water on the umbrella will fall on the floor of the room or make the user feel uncomfortable. Therefore, in the conventional case, the umbrella is stored in a separate storage box, or the user shakes the umbrella and removes water or puts it in a plastic bag to carry it indoors. However, if you keep it in the storage box, it may cause the umbrella to be lost, and in other cases, water may remain or waste of vinyl.

In addition, in a space where many people gather, not only can the environment be polluted by an umbrella, but it can also cause damage when contacted with others, so a device that can dry the umbrella within a short time when entering the room is required.

The present invention by applying the principle of the hot air used in the hand dryer to dry the umbrella in recognition of the above needs to develop a device to remove the moisture of the umbrella in a short time to improve the inconvenience of consumers and to prevent indoor pollution To help.

The umbrella is inserted into the umbrella stand of the umbrella dryer to remove moisture from the umbrella by using hot air generated by the blowing means. At this time, by introducing a rotating means to reduce the size of the umbrella dryer can make a hot air flow path only in one portion.

You can shorten the time it takes to get your umbrella dry when entering the room.

By completely removing the water from the umbrella, you can prevent accidents caused by the water remaining on the ground.

It is possible to prevent the loss situation that can occur when the umbrella is stored in the storage box, and to prevent the indiscriminate consumption of vinyl that occurs when using the vinyl storage.

By pressing the power supply located at the bottom of the umbrella stand to facilitate the use of the device by blocking the inconvenience that may occur to users without prior knowledge of the device.

Water was removed from the umbrella through an inclined discharge path at the bottom of the dryer so that it was discharged by itself along the discharge path so that no separate management was required.

Referring to the present invention with reference to the accompanying drawings as follows.

1 is a perspective view of an umbrella dryer according to a first embodiment of the present invention and is applied to FIG. 1A.

Referring to Figure 1 with reference to the appearance of the umbrella dryer according to the first embodiment is removed from the umbrella stand (3) and the mirror (2) and the umbrella to see the inside of the main body 1 gathered along the discharge path There is a discharge hose 4 which drains the water out.

As shown in FIG. 1, an umbrella is inserted into an umbrella stand to extend an umbrella as shown in FIG. 2. When the end of the open umbrella presses the power 12, the power detection means 14 detects a signal of power.

When it is detected that the power source 12 is pressed, the fixing unit 10 selectively operated by the sensing means 14 is extended to hold the umbrella, and the fan motor 16 is operated.

The wind emitted by the fan motor 16 is converted into a hot air passing through the hot wire 17, which flows through the guide flow path (18). Some of the hot air flowing in the guide flow path 18 follows the injection flow path 11 and is sprayed into the umbrella through the injection nozzle 13.

Hot air sprayed through the injection nozzle 13 serves to remove moisture in the umbrella. At this time, the spray nozzle 13 faces the lower part so that the hot air flows on the umbrella.

The removed water is discharged along the drainage path 19 through the gap between the power source 12.

2 and 2a are a perspective view and a cross-sectional view of an umbrella dryer according to a second embodiment of the present invention. The main body 21 has an umbrella stand 23, which is arranged in a number, a side mirror 22 to view the drying process, and a discharge hose 24 from which water is removed.

When the umbrella is inserted into the umbrella stand 23, the sensing means 38 connected to the rotating means 35 checks whether the umbrella is properly inserted. Then, the rotary motor 37 and the fan motor 34 which are selectively operated by the sensing means 38 are operated.

When the rotary motor 37 located at the upper end of the main body operates, the rotating means 35 connected thereto starts to rotate, and the umbrella fixed to the rotating means 35 starts to rotate.

The wind generated by the fan motor 34 is changed into hot air passing through the hot wire 32, which follows a guide flow path 36 and is partially sprayed into the umbrella through the spray nozzle 31.

At this time, as in the first embodiment, the spray nozzle 31 faces downward so that hot air does not go out. Since the umbrella rotates by the rotating means 35, even if the injection nozzle 31 is only in one part, the water of all surfaces can be removed.

The water falling from the umbrella flows through the discharge path 39 inclined toward the discharge port through the gap beside the rotating means 35 and is discharged through the discharge hose 24.
